Seems too small to be usefull
This thing is tiny. To the point that it's pretty limited as an artist model. They say 5.9" but it's only 5". And yes, that 0.9" would have made a difference. At this tiny size any increase would make a difference. One solution might be to pose it and then take a picture which of course you can view at a much larger size. I haven't tried that yet but it brings me to the next issue. Range of motion. It's pretty limited in important joints like the hips and shoulders which makes many poses impossible. I was hoping for more versatility from this type of figure.As far as quality I think it's pretty good. The parts are molded well and there is no excess flash on them. Some of the joints are pretty stiff initially but you just have to carefully work them back and forth a bit. It came with nine sets of hands, three sets of clasped hands and a couple right hands that can hold the couple things you get with it. A sword and shield and a couple cups. There is also a stand and a table/bench to pose her on. Her shape is bit weird in that her head and butt are a bit big which gives her the look of a teenage manga character. She's obviously more anatomically correct then a wooden figure but with such tiny limbs you're going to need a blow up for it to be any added value.I need to do some actual testing to decided if I'm keeping it but at this point I'm leaning toward getting my $20 dollars back and putting it into a 12" TOA figure but that's a huge jump up in price.
